KKR releases Bangladesh pacer Mustafizur Rahman following BCCI instructions

Kolkata Knight Riders (KKR) have released Bangladesh pacer Mustafizur Rahman from their IPL squad following instructions from the BCCI. Earlier, confirming the move, the franchise said in a statement that the board has permitted KKR to sign a replacement in accordance with IPL regulations.

BCCI secretary Devajit Saikia confirmed the decision. Rahman was picked up by the KKR for 9.20 crore rupees at the December mini-auction, the highest price ever paid for a Bangladeshi player in IPL history. The 30-year-old pacer has taken 65 wickets in 60 IPL matches since making his debut in 2016.
